This is a free-meter vocal style characterized by unmeasured phrasing and intense, melismatic ornamentation. Unlike rhythmic dance music, Uzun Hava is "usûlsüz" (without a fixed beat), allowing the performer to stretch lines to maximize emotional impact.
Performances typically center on themes of longing, separation, epic heroism, and the hardships of exile ( gurbet ). About Muşlu İhsan
